10. Data Subject Rights
As a data subject, we will provide you with the following rights:
- Right to Access
You have the right to request access to your personal data that we process. This means you can ask us to provide you with information about what personal data we hold about you and how we use it.
- Right to Rectification
You can request the correction or updating of your personal data if it is inaccurate or incomplete. We will make the necessary changes and inform any third parties to whom we have disclosed the data.
- Right to Erasure (Right to Be Forgotten)
You can request the deletion of your personal data under certain circumstances. This right is not absolute and can be exercised if the data is no longer necessary, you withdraw consent, or the data processing is unlawful.
- Right to Restriction of Processing
You have the right to request the restriction of the processing of your personal data under specific circumstances. This means we will limit the way we use your data but not delete it entirely. This right might be exercised when you contest the accuracy of the data, the processing is unlawful, or you need the data for legal claims.
- Right to Data Portability
You can request a copy of your personal data in a structured, commonly used, machine-readable format, or you can ask us to transmit it directly to another data controller where technically feasible. This right is applicable when processing is based on consent or the performance of a contract.
- Right to Object
You have the right to object to the processing of your personal data, including processing based on legitimate interests or for direct marketing purposes. We will stop processing your data for such purposes unless we can demonstrate compelling legitimate grounds that override your interests, rights, and freedoms.
- Automated Decision-Making and Profiling
You have the right not to be subject to a decision based solely on automated processing, including profiling, which has legal or significant effects on you. You may request human intervention in the decision-making process. We will inform you when such decisions are made, provide you with the opportunity to express your point of view, and ensure there are human interventions available.
- Withdraw Consent
If we process your personal data based on your consent, you have the right to withdraw that consent at any time. This will not affect the lawfulness of processing based on consent before its withdrawal.

12. Cookies and Tracking Technology
We may use “cookies” (or similar tracking technology) on our websites. Cookies are text files that our web server may play on your hard disk to store your preferences. When you visit our website, you will be presented with a cookie banner or pop-up requesting your consent to use non-essential cookies, if any. You have the right to accept or decline the use of such cookies. Your consent can be managed and changed at any time through your device or browser settings.
Cookies, by themselves, do not provide us with any personal data unless you explicitly choose and consent to provide this information to us. Once you choose and consent to provide personal data, however, this information may be linked to the data stored in the cookie. If you choose to turn off a collection of cookies through your device or browser, certain features of our service may not function properly without the aid of cookies.
Our websites may also incorporate third-party cookies and tracking technologies. These technologies are subject to the privacy policies and practices of the respective third parties. We encourage you to review the privacy policies of these third parties for information on how they collect and use your personal data.

Local specific information: California
We do not sell your information for monetary gain.
Under the laws of California, when we disclose personal information to a third party for any benefit, this can be considered a “sale” or “share” of personal information, even if such third party does not use the personal information for any other purpose. We “share” personal information if we disclose personal information to a third party for purposes of cross-context behavioral advertising.
Request to Do Not Track/Opt-Out: Amma does not sell your personal information. You can opt out of sharing your personal information with our analytics and advertising partners. This includes opting out of “sale” and “Do Not Track” requirements.
Do Not Track is a web browsing setting that adds a signal to your browser header that tells other websites that you do not want their tracking cookies. Amma currently does not respond to such signals in browsers. To exercise this right you can contact us at help@amma.family.
Request to know/access: In addition to the other rights mentioned in this policy, you have the right to request to know (i) the personal and sensitive information we have collected about you and our purposes of use; and (ii) the categories, sources, and third parties involved in personal information we have collected about you or “sold” or disclosed in the past 12 months. You may exercise your right to request to know twice a year, free of charge.
Shine the Light: California Civil Code Section 1798.83 permits our customers who are California residents to request and obtain from us once a year, free of charge, information about the personal information (if any) we have disclosed to third parties for direct marketing purposes in the preceding calendar year. If applicable, this information would include a list of the categories of personal information that was shared and the names and addresses of all third parties with which we shared information in the immediately preceding calendar year. If you are a California resident and would like to make such a request, please contact us at help@amma.family.
References to “personal data” in this Privacy Policy include “sensitive/personal information” as defined under California laws.

How can you access, rectify or cancel your personal data, or oppose its use, or revoke your consent for the processing of your personal data?
You have the right to know what personal data we have about you, what we use them for, and the conditions of use we give them (Access). Likewise, it is your right to request the correction of your personal information in case it is outdated, inaccurate, or incomplete (Rectification); that we remove it from our records or databases when it considers that it is not being used in accordance with the principles, duties and obligations provided for in the regulations (Cancellation); as well as oppose the use of your personal data for specific purposes (Opposition). These rights are known as ARCO rights.
You can revoke the consent that, if applicable, you have given us for the processing of your personal data.
You or your legal representative may exercise any of the rights of access, rectification, cancellation or opposition (hereinafter "ARCO Rights"), as well as revoke your consent for the processing of your personal data by sending an e-mail to the address help@amma.family. We will provide you with an ARCO Rights Request Form to attend to your request in a timely manner.
It is necessary that you complete all the fields indicated in the ARCO Rights Request Form and accompany it with a copy of your valid official identification.
In order for your request to be followed up, you or your legal representative must correctly prove your identity, for which it is necessary to confirm the ownership of the e-mail you inserted in the Sites, as well as to attach a copy of any valid official identification.
In the event that the information provided is erroneous, insufficient, or it is not possible to prove your identity, within five (5) business days following receipt of your application form, you may be required to provide the missing information. You will have ten (10) business days to meet the request, counted from the day after you received it. If you do not respond within that period, the corresponding request will be deemed not submitted.
You will be notified of the decision made, within a maximum period of twenty (20) business days from the date on which the request was received, so that, if appropriate, it can be made effective within fifteen (15) business days after the answer is communicated. The answer will be given electronically to the e-mail address you used to register on the website. The aforementioned time periods may be extended a single time by a period of equal length, provided that such action is justified by the circumstances of the case.
